…By Larry John for TDPel Media. In a recent development, a first-time lawmaker named Moses Sule has been elected as the Speaker of the 10th Plateau State House of Assembly.

Sule, who represents Mikang State Constituency and previously served as the vice chairman of Mikang Local Government Area, was chosen for the position during the assembly’s session on Tuesday.

Fom Gwottson, the member representing Jos South constituency, was also elected as the deputy speaker during the brief inaugural ceremony.

Following the oath-taking ceremony, Sule proceeded to administer the oath of office to the newly elected legislators.

Composition of the Plateau State House of Assembly

The Plateau State House of Assembly consists of a total of 24 members.

Of these, the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) holds 16 seats, the All Progressives Congress (APC) holds seven seats, and the Young Progressives Party (YPP) holds one seat.

Court Reinstates Nuhu Abok as Plateau Speaker

Meanwhile, Nuhu Abok has been reinstated as the Speaker of the Plateau State House of Assembly by a Plateau High Court.

Abok had previously been impeached by the assembly in October 2021.

However, Justice M. L Musa ruled that the impeachment was illegal and therefore null and void.

The court also awarded costs amounting to N1.5 million for appearance and N138,000 for filing the matter against the defendants.

Abok’s Reaction and Appreciation

Upon his reinstatement, Speaker Abok expressed his gratitude to the people of Plateau for their support during his ordeal.

He highlighted that the court’s decision vindicated him from the illegal impeachment and emphasized the need for peaceful proceedings in the assembly.

Abok affirmed his willingness to work harmoniously with the executive, stressing that unity among the members was essential for the peace and progress of the state.

He emphasized that the court’s ruling had clarified the situation surrounding the purported impeachment.
